State Budget for Fiscal Years 2020 and 2021 (Connecticut General Assembly)
Jun 26, 2019
On Tuesday, June 4, 2019, the Connecticut General Assembly adopted a biennial state budget for fiscal years 2020 and 2021, which was then signed into law on June 26, 2019 by Governor Ned Lamont. This resource contains the budget's bill language, fiscal note, bill analysis, agency budget sheets, and estimates of statutory municipal aid.
